Deutschnationale Volkspartei (DNVP - German National People's Party) was a national-conservative political party in Germany during the Weimar Republic (1918 to 1933). Before the rise of the Nazi Party, it was the major conservative and nationalist party in Germany. It was an alliance of nationalists, reactionary monarchists, and antisemitic elements. After 1929, the DNVP cooperated with the Nazis and supported Hitler's appointment as Chancellor in January 1933. After that, the party quickly lost influence and eventually dissolved itself in June 1933, giving way to the Nazis' single-party dictatorship. During World War II (WWII), several prominent former DNVP members were involved in the German resistance against the Nazis and took part in the assassination plot against Hitler in 1944.

Overall Condition and Pre-Restoration Defects with Quality of Restoration: good to very good. The poster had creases, scuffs, and tiny bits of paper loss on the folds, with many smudges and scuffs in the solid black areas. It had small paper loss in the top left blank corner and in the left of the top blank border. Overall, the poster was in good condition prior to linenbacking. The poster was pretty well backed, but you can see signs of the above defects and the restoration of the above defects.
